MG PA of AC Sears at the RAC Rally, 1939. Artist: Bill Brunell
MG PA 847 cc. Vehicle Reg. No. MG3638. Driver: Sears, A.C Chassis No. PA1333. Place: R.A.C. Rally. Date: 25-29.4.39
